An independent public foundation of the State of Baden-Wuerttemberg associated with the University of Heidelberg, that is one of Europe''s premier research institutions dedicated to mental health. The CIMH combines a clinical inpatient (300 beds) and outpatient program in adult psychiatry, addiction, childhood and adolescent psychiatry and psychotherapy with outstanding research facilities, including two dedicated research fMRI scanners (currently 1.5 Ts and 3 Ts, from next summer 2 3 Ts magnets), an 9.4 Ts animal fMRI scanner, high-throughput facilities for genotyping and molecular biology, neuropsychology and an extensive transgenic animal (both mice and rats) and animal behavior assessment facility.

An agency responsible for the evaluation and supervision of medicines developed by pharmaceutical companies for use in the European Union. Its main responsibility is the protection and promotion of public and animal health through the evaluation and supervision of medicines for human and veterinary use. The Agency also plays a role in stimulating innovation and research in the pharmaceutical sector. The Agency gives scientific advice and other assistance to companies for the development of new medicines. It publishes guidelines on quality-, safety- and efficacy-testing requirements. A dedicated SME Office provides special assistance to small and medium-sized enterprises.

A not-for-profit biomedical research institute whose main aim is to help defend human health and life. Research programs span from the molecular level to the whole human being, and the findings help build up the basis for developing new drugs, and making existing ones more effective. The main research headings are the battle against cancer, nervous and mental illnesses, cardiovascular and kidney diseases, rare diseases and the toxic effects of environmental contaminants, mother and child''''s health. The Institute is also involved in research on pain relief and drug addiction. Parallel to its biomedical investigations, the Mario Negri Institute runs training schemes for laboratory technicians and graduate researchers. It takes part in a range of initiatives to communicate information in biomedicine, on a general level and with the specific aims of improving health care practice, and encouraging more rational use of drugs. There are also research units in Bergamo, at Ranica - near Bergamo - and at Santa Maria Imbaro, near Chieti.

Membership supported, nonprofit organization established dedicated to improving the lives of persons affected by ataxia through support, education, and research. The Foundation's primary purpose is to support promising ataxia research and to provide vital programs and services for ataxia families. The Foundation first began direct funding of ataxia research through the NAF Research Seed-Money Program. Since that time, the Foundation has established additional research programs which have included programs such as the NAF Young Investigator Award, the NAF Fellowship Award and other research initiatives. NAF research programs continue to fund promising ataxia research studies throughout the world. The Foundation supports research in dominant ataxia (including SCAs), recessive ataxia (including Friedreich's) and sporadic ataxia. The Foundation has developed an extensive library of NAF brochures, fact sheets, books, and videos on ataxia. Also available to its members is the Foundation's quarterly news publication, Generations. This 48 page ataxia news magazine provides the latest information on ataxia research, articles on living with ataxia, personal accounts from ataxia families throughout the United States, and much more.

A set of standalone software programs for the automated processing of any genomic loci, with an emphasis on datasets consisting of ChIP-derived signal peaks. The software is able to identify individual binding / modification sites from enrichment loci, retrieve peak region sequences for motif discovery, and integrate experimental data with different classes of annotated elements throughout the genome. PeakAnalyzer requires a peak file and a feature annotation file in BED or GTF format. Complete annotation files for the current builds of the human (HG19) and mouse (MM9) genomes are provided with the software distribution.

Software for scanning reads from short-read sequenced genomes against a human breakpoint library to accurately identify structural variants (SVs). The library of breakpoints at nucleotide resolution were assembled from collating and standardizing ~2,000 published structural variants (SVs). For each breakpoint, its ancestral state (through comparison to primate genomes) was inferred and its mechanism of formation (e.g., nonallelic homologous recombination, NAHR).

A drug discovery company focused on small-molecule drugs targeting G-protein-coupled receptors (GPCRs), the largest family of druggable targets. Heptares creates new medicines targeting previously undruggable or challenging GPCRs, a superfamily of receptors linked to many diseases. They are pioneering a structure-based drug design approach to GPCRs, leveraging proprietary technologies for protein stabilization, structure determination, and fragment-based discovery. Their partners include Cubist, MorphoSys, AstraZeneca, MedImmune and Takeda. Their objective is to build a broad pipeline of novel medicines to transform the treatment of serious diseases, including Alzheimer's disease, schizophrenia, diabetes, ADHD and chronic migraine.

A virtual organization that promotes transdisciplinary research into anthropogeny, or the study of human origins. The research interests are broad and include finding the structural and molecular differences between humans and apes, identifying and explaining external mechanisms, and defining the evolutionary origins of humans. The center hosts symposia as well as visiting professors for the anthropogeny graduate program.

Software to identify genes targeted by somatic copy-number alterations (SCNAs) that drive cancer growth. By separating SCNA profiles into underlying arm-level and focal alterations, they improve the estimation of background rates for each category.
